服务器CPU与普通CPU的核心区别在于:前者追求极致的稳定性、多任务并发处理能力和7×24小时不间断运行寿命,而后者侧重于单核高频性能、性价比及多媒体娱乐体验,两者在架构设计、散热方案及纠错机制上存在本质差异。
服务器CPU和普通CPU的区别:架构与设计的底层逻辑
当我们谈论硬件时,不能只看频率,服务器CPU和普通CPU在诞生之初,服务场景就完全不同,普通CPU是为“人”设计的,你需要它快速打开网页、流畅运行游戏;服务器CPU是为“机器”和“数据”设计的,它需要同时服务成千上万的用户请求,且不能出错。
多路支持能力对比
这是两者最直观的差异之一,普通家用电脑主板通常只支持一颗CPU,即便高端工作站偶尔支持双路,也极为罕见,而服务器主板天生就是为多处理器协同工作设计的。
- 普通CPU:绝大多数仅支持单路安装,即便你购买的是Intel Xeon或AMD EPYC系列,如果在普通主板上,也只能发挥单颗的性能。
- 服务器CPU:支持双路、四路甚至更多处理器并行工作,通过QPI(快速通道互联)或UPI(通用平台互联)技术,多颗CPU之间共享内存和缓存,实现真正的分布式计算,这种架构让服务器能够轻松处理海量并发数据,而不会造成单点瓶颈。
纠错机制(ECC)的必要性
在数据中心,数据丢失意味着巨大的经济损失,服务器CPU必须搭配ECC(错误检查和纠正)内存使用。
- 普通CPU:通常不支持ECC内存,或者仅在特定高端型号中有限支持,内存中的比特翻转(Bit Flip)可能导致程序崩溃或数据损坏,但在个人娱乐中,这种概率极低且后果可接受。
- 服务器CPU
:硬件层面强制要求ECC支持,当内存数据发生错误时,CPU能自动检测并修正,确保业务连续性,业内专家指出,这种硬件级的容错能力是服务器稳定运行的基石,也是普通消费者难以感知的隐形成本。
性能侧重点:单核高频 vs 多核并发
很多人误以为CPU频率越高越好,这在服务器领域是个误区,服务器CPU和普通CPU在性能调优方向上背道而驰。
主频与核心数的博弈
普通CPU为了响应你的鼠标点击和游戏渲染,必须拥有极高的单核主频,而服务器CPU为了处理数据库查询、虚拟化集群或大数据分析,更看重核心数量和线程数。
- 普通CPU:主频通常在3.0GHz至5.0GHz甚至更高,Intel Core i9系列或AMD Ryzen 9系列,通过提升单核性能来缩短任务等待时间。
- 服务器CPU:主频往往较低,通常在2.0GHz至3.5GHz之间,但核心数量惊人,动辄几十甚至上百个核心,这种设计使得服务器在处理成千上万个轻量级任务(如Web请求)时,效率远超高频单核CPU。
缓存架构的差异
缓存是CPU与内存之间的缓冲区,对性能影响巨大。
- 普通CPU:L3缓存通常在10MB至60MB之间,设计目标是减少游戏加载时间和应用程序响应延迟。
- 服务器CPU:L3缓存可能高达数百MB,更大的缓存意味着CPU可以从本地获取更多数据,减少对缓慢内存的访问次数,在数据库事务处理中,这种缓存命中率提升带来的性能增益是巨大的。
稳定性与可靠性:7×24小时运行的保障
服务器CPU和普通CPU在耐用性上的差距,体现在材料、设计和软件支持的全生命周期中。
散热与功耗管理
普通CPU的散热方案相对灵活,风冷、水冷均可,且允许短时过热降频,服务器CPU则有着严格的功耗和散热规范。
- 普通CPU:TDP(热设计功耗)范围较广,从35W到250W不等,用户可以根据机箱空间选择散热方案,甚至超频以换取额外性能,尽管这会牺牲寿命。
- 服务器CPU:TDP通常较高,且功耗曲线经过严格校准,服务器机箱采用高密度风道设计,配合冗余电源,确保在高负载下温度恒定,一旦温度异常,服务器会优先保护硬件而非维持性能,这与普通CPU的“性能优先”策略截然不同。
生命周期与支持周期
购买硬件不仅是买产品,更是买服务。
- 普通CPU:消费级产品通常提供3年质保,生命周期较短,厂商会在1-2年内推出新一代产品,旧型号迅速退市。
- 服务器CPU:提供长达5-10年的供货保证和支持周期,对于企业而言,这意味着基础设施无需频繁更换,降低了总体拥有成本(TCO),据工信部数据,企业级硬件的长期稳定性是企业数字化转型的关键考量因素。
价格与适用场景:如何做出正确选择
理解了上述区别,选择CPU就不再是看参数,而是看场景,服务器CPU和普通CPU的价格差异巨大,但并非越贵越好。
价格区间对比
- 普通CPU:价格亲民,从几百元到几千元不等,Intel Core i5或AMD Ryzen 5系列,是大多数家庭和办公用户的首选。
- 服务器CPU:价格昂贵,单颗价格可达数千至数万元,Intel Xeon Gold或AMD EPYC系列,不仅CPU本身贵,还需要搭配昂贵的服务器主板、ECC内存和冗余电源。
场景化建议
- 个人用户/小型工作室
:选择普通CPU,你需要的是游戏帧数、视频剪辑速度和日常办公流畅度,服务器CPU的多核优势在此场景下毫无用武之地,反而因主频低导致体验下降。
- 企业数据中心/云计算服务商:必须选择服务器CPU,你需要的是高并发处理能力、数据完整性保障和长期稳定运行,普通CPU在此场景下会因过热、数据错误或频繁故障导致业务中断,损失远超硬件差价。
虚拟化与容器化需求
随着云原生技术的普及,虚拟化成为主流,服务器CPU的VT-x/AMD-V等虚拟化指令集优化更好,支持更多的虚拟机实例,普通CPU虽然也支持虚拟化,但在资源隔离、调度效率和安全性上远不及服务器CPU。
常见问题解答:服务器CPU和普通CPU的区别
服务器CPU和普通CPU的区别在于频率吗?
频率只是表象,核心区别在于架构设计,服务器CPU牺牲单核频率以换取多核并发、ECC纠错支持和长期稳定性;普通CPU则追求高频率以提供即时响应和多媒体性能,选择时应根据负载类型决定,而非单纯比较GHz数值。
普通电脑可以插服务器CPU吗?
通常不可以,服务器CPU需要特定的服务器主板(如支持LGA 4189或SP5插槽的主板),这些主板具备多路互联、ECC内存通道和冗余电源接口,普通消费级主板物理接口不同,且不支持多CPU互联,强行安装不仅无法点亮,还可能损坏硬件。
服务器CPU和普通CPU的区别对游戏有影响吗?
有显著负面影响,游戏主要依赖单核性能和缓存延迟,服务器CPU的低主频和多核心设计并不适合游戏渲染,使用服务器CPU玩游戏,帧数往往低于同价位的普通CPU,且由于缺乏针对游戏优化的指令集,体验会更差,游戏玩家应坚决避免使用服务器CPU。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/458033.html



